Question : Fonts and MS Access Forms
If i select a font within in the forms property "Font Style," does it save the actual font file? Or does the target computer have to have that font already installed on their local system.
The reason I ask is because I want to use this font I purchased with is not a windows default font. I see it it with the forms properties. Is it only going to show up on my local computer where the installed font is located?
If so is there a way to include it with the database file.
Answer : Fonts and MS Access Forms
The target computer has to have that font already installed on their local system
